UAE Fuel Prices – July 2026
UAE fuel prices have been reduced for July 2026 compared to June 2026, providing savings for motorists across all fuel categories. The updated prices are:
- Super 98: Dh3.40/L (down 55 fils from Dh3.95/L)
- Special 95: Dh3.29/L (down 54 fils from Dh3.83/L)
- E-Plus 91: Dh3.21/L (down 55 fils from Dh3.76/L)
- Diesel: Dh3.60/L (down 73 fils from Dh4.33/L)
The largest reduction was seen in Diesel, making July a more affordable month for both private motorists and commercial fleet operators.

Fuel-Saving Tips for UAE Drivers
To reduce fuel consumption even further:
- Maintain correct tyre pressure
- Avoid sudden acceleration and harsh braking
- Keep up with scheduled servicing
- Remove unnecessary weight from your vehicle
- Switch off the engine during long waiting periods
- Use quality engine oil recommended by the manufacturer
- Ensure the air conditioning system is working efficiently
